Summary
George Woodward is a seasoned medical professional with extensive experience in emergency medicine and healthcare management. Currently serving as the Chief of Emergency Medicine at Seattle Children's Hospital, he has a robust background in clinical research and medical education. With an MBA from the Wharton School, he blends clinical expertise with business acumen, making him a valuable asset in healthcare leadership. His dedication to pediatrics and patient safety has been demonstrated throughout his career, especially during his tenure at The Children's Hospital of Philadelphia. George is known for his innovative approaches to emergency care and transport services, significantly improving patient outcomes. His commitment to education is evident in his role as a professor at the University of Washington School of Medicine. Outside of his clinical duties, he is passionate about advancing pediatric healthcare practices and mentoring the next generation of medical professionals.
